Explanation
This Bible verse is like a comforting hug from God for those who are feeling sad or troubled. It says that when Jesus comes back with His powerful angels, He will bring relief to all who are going through hard times.
Imagine if you were feeling really upset because something didn’t go the way you hoped. Maybe a friend was mean to you, or you didn’t do as well on a test as you wanted. When Jesus returns, it will be like Him giving you a big, warm hug and making everything okay again.
Just like how a hug from a loved one can make us feel better when we're sad, knowing that Jesus will come back to bring relief can give us hope and comfort during tough times. So remember, no matter what you're going through, Jesus is always there to give you the strength and peace you need.

Life Application
The message in 2 Thessalonians 1:7 reminds us that when Jesus returns, He will bring relief to those who are suffering. Children can apply this by showing kindness and offering help to those who are going through hard times. At home, they can comfort a sibling who is upset or help with chores without being asked. In school, they can be a good friend to someone who is feeling left out or struggling with schoolwork. With friends, they can listen and support them when they are going through a difficult situation. By being a source of relief and comfort to others, children can reflect the love and compassion of Jesus in their daily lives.
Craft or Activity
One creative activity to help children understand and remember the message of 2 Thessalonians 1:7 is to have them create angel-themed stress balls. You can provide balloons, flour or rice to fill the balloons, and markers to decorate the balloons like angels. As they create their stress balls, you can explain how the verse talks about Jesus coming with His mighty angels to give relief to those who are suffering. This hands-on activity can help children visualize the concept and remember the message in a fun and engaging way.
